Key Features to Look For

When shopping, keep these important features in mind.

Waterproof vs. Water-Resistant

  • Waterproof: This is the best protection. It means water cannot get through the fabric. Look for jackets with sealed seams. This is where the stitching is covered to stop leaks.
  • Water-Resistant: These jackets can handle light rain or drizzle for a short time. Water will bead up and roll off. They aren’t as good for heavy, long-lasting rain.

Breathability

This sounds tricky, but it’s important. A breathable jacket lets sweat vapor escape. This stops you from feeling clammy and overheated inside. Look for ratings like “MVTR” (Moisture Vapor Transmission Rate). Higher numbers mean better breathability.

Weight and Packability

Lightweight is the name of the game! You want a jacket that doesn’t weigh you down. Check the product description for its weight. Also, see if it packs into its own pocket or a small stuff sack. This makes it easy to carry.

Hood Design

A good hood protects your face and head. Look for adjustable hoods. You can tighten them to keep wind and rain out. Some hoods can also be rolled up and stored in the collar.

Zipper Quality

Zippers are often weak spots. Look for water-resistant zippers. Some jackets have storm flaps over the main zipper. This adds another layer of protection.

Pockets

Think about how many pockets you need and where you want them. Handwarmer pockets are nice for chilly days. Chest pockets are good for phones or wallets.

Important Materials

The fabric makes a big difference in how well your jacket works.

Nylon and Polyester

These are common and durable fabrics. They are often treated with a waterproof coating. Many lightweight jackets use ripstop nylon or polyester. This means they have a special weave that makes them resistant to tearing.

Gore-Tex and Similar Membranes

These are high-tech materials. They have tiny pores that let sweat vapor out but keep water droplets from coming in. Gore-Tex is a well-known brand. Many other brands offer similar waterproof and breathable membranes.

DWR (Durable Water Repellent) Finish

This is a special coating applied to the outside of the fabric. It makes water bead up and roll off. Over time, this coating can wear off. You can often reapply it.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

A few things tell you if a jacket is built to last.

Seam Sealing

As mentioned, sealed seams are crucial for waterproof jackets. Look for taped seams. This means the seams are covered with waterproof tape.

Adjustable Cuffs and Hem

Cuffs with Velcro or elastic help you seal out wind and rain. An adjustable hem cord lets you cinch the bottom of the jacket. This prevents drafts from coming up.

Ventilation Features

Some jackets have pit zips. These are zippers under the arms. They let you open them up for extra airflow when you’re working hard.

Build Quality and Stitching

Look closely at the stitching. It should be neat and even. Poor stitching can lead to leaks and the jacket falling apart.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: What makes a rain jacket “lightweight”?

A: Lightweight rain jackets use thin, strong fabrics. They also have fewer features like heavy linings. This keeps their weight down.

Q: How do I know if a jacket is truly waterproof?

A: Look for “waterproof” in the description. Check that the seams are sealed or taped. A hydrostatic head rating of 10,000mm or higher is usually good.

Q: How often should I wash my rain jacket?

A: Wash it when it looks dirty or the water stops beading up. Follow the care label instructions. Too much washing can wear down the DWR finish.

Q: Can I use a water-resistant jacket in heavy rain?

A: A water-resistant jacket is best for light rain or drizzle. For heavy rain, you need a waterproof jacket with sealed seams.

Q: What is a DWR finish and why is it important?

A: DWR stands for Durable Water Repellent. It’s a coating that makes water bead up and roll off the fabric. It helps keep the jacket’s surface dry.

Q: How can I reapply the DWR finish?

A: You can buy DWR spray or wash-in treatments. Clean your jacket first, then follow the product instructions. This restores water repellency.

Q: Are pit zips really necessary on a lightweight rain jacket?

A: Pit zips add great ventilation. They are very useful if you get hot while hiking or doing other activities. They help you stay comfortable.

Q: What does “breathability rating” mean?

A: Breathability ratings, like MVTR, tell you how well the jacket lets moisture vapor escape. Higher numbers mean the jacket breathes better.

Q: How should I store my lightweight rain jacket?

A: Store it clean and dry. Avoid stuffing it away wet, as this can damage the fabric. Hang it up or fold it loosely.

Q: Can I wear a fleece or sweater under a lightweight rain jacket?

A: Yes, absolutely! Lightweight rain jackets are often designed to be worn as an outer shell. Layering with a fleece or sweater underneath provides warmth.
